The course is designed around you and your individual requirements and experience – your instructors will spend some time establishing this and ensuring what they do is relevant and useful to you. This may mean the instructors split the larger group into a number of smaller ones.
As a rough guide the course will follow the following format:
- Introductions, meet the team, course housekeeping, pre course admin
- General rider research – what do you want to achieve?
- Introduction to electric bikes
- Bike fitting, helmets, clothing
- General e-bike riding – off road and traffic free
- Team engagement – personalised travel advice from our experienced team-learn about local cycle routes, commuter tips, maintenance hints, general riding advice etc.
- Road riding – by choice the team will take you out on quiet roads close to the training venue, to build confidence and road skills in a controlled environment. If you wish to remain off road and continue practicing that’s fine too.
Please note that we will be delivering the training to all districts across Leicestershire. This course is for Leicestershire County residents only. More courses will become available in your area in due course!
